Overview:
We are seeking a talented Senior Game Designer/Mathematician to develop and apply advanced mathematical models to our products. The ideal candidate will be proficient in mathematical modeling, and possess a strong understanding of the underlying principles that drive these models.
Responsibilities:
Develop Mathematical Models

Create theoretical solution to fully understand the statistical characteristics of the game.
Build simulations to check work and ensure accuracy.
Create XML configuration for the game service to implement functionality of the game.
Complete all documentation with accuracy.
Provide support for mathematical queries.
Respond quickly and professionally to queries relating to game mathematics.
Perform investigations into game performance.
Use domain understanding to find solutions and identify risks.
Communication with relevant stakeholders on support queries.

Game Design

Monitor industry trends.
Perform analysis into game performance to identify best design practices.
Implementing new best practice and innovation.
Develop an understanding of player psychology to improve game design.
Generate new feature ideas to improve player experience.
Iterate design to ensure that the intended player experience is achieved.

Research and Develop New Tools and Processes

Build generic solutions to improve efficiency and accuracy of future game mathematics solutions i.e. identify where there is value to develop a generic solution, and evolve into a standardised tool set to use in many different ways.
Improve on the existing set of tools within the mathematics society to automate and streamline processes.
Educate and share knowledge society members on new and improved tools and processes.

Provide Strategic Direction for Development

Collaborate with others to expose value-adding development opportunities, and communicate and influence strategies effectively to achieve buy-in from relevant stakeholders.
Make decisions that properly prioritize long-term and short-term projects in order to constantly improve the team's efficiency and product success.
Identify areas of development that will provide the most value for the team as a whole.

Qualifications:

Degree in Mathematics or similar.
Expert mathematical and problem solving skills.
Expert experience with mathematical and statistical modelling.
Advanced domain and product knowledge.
Advanced experience with Excel and C#.
Intermediate experience mentoring others.
